Description
A whole roast chicken glazed with a delightful cranberry-maple mixture that balances savory and sweet flavors, perfect for family gatherings.
Ingredients
- Whole Chicken (about 4-5 lbs)
- Fresh Cranberries (2 cups)
- Maple Syrup (1/2 cup)
- Olive Oil (1/4 cup)
- Garlic (5 cloves, minced)
- Thyme (2 teaspoons, fresh)
- Salt and Pepper (to taste)
- Lemon (1, zested and juiced)
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Rinse the chicken under cold water and pat it dry with paper towels.
- Rub salt and pepper generously inside and outside of the chicken.
- In a small saucepan over medium heat, combine fresh cranberries, maple syrup, minced garlic, and thyme. Simmer until the cranberries burst, about 10 minutes.
- Stir in lemon juice and zest before removing from heat.
- Place the chicken in a roasting pan and pour half of the glaze over the top.
- Insert a meat thermometer into the thickest part of the thigh and roast for 1 to 1.5 hours, basting every 30 minutes.
- Once cooked, let the chicken rest for at least 15 minutes before serving.
